MDOT Reality Check: Michigan Doesn't Know How to Build Roads

It's easy to find examples of roads in Michigan that saw repairs just a few years ago and are falling apart again.  It's also east to see why drivers and taxpayers think shoddy workmanship is to blame.  Michigan follows nation design and construction standards, and is a leader in roadwork warranties.  MDOT can and does build quality roads, but Michigan's current investment in transportation doesn't support much more than short term fixes for our aging system.
